WebMar 25, 2024 · Although Michigan individual income tax returns are due on April 15 th, the home heating credit claim (MI-1040CR-7) is not due to the Michigan Department of Treasury until September 30th. Again, you may still file MI-1040CR-7 to claim this credit even if you do not have to file a Michigan individual return for the tax year.

WebSales of electricity, natural or artificial gas and home heating fuels for residential use are taxed at a 4% rate. Michigan does not allow city or local units to impose sales tax. Use Tax Use tax is a companion tax to sales tax.
